City Council
The Madison City Council is composed of seven elected officials. Five are elected by their districts, and two are elected by the population of Madison as a whole. Council members serve four-year terms and have no term limits. The most recent election was in 2023, with terms beginning January 1, 2024.

Meeting Information:
City Council meets the first and third Tuesday of the month at 5:30 PM. Meetings are held in the Council Chambers at City Hall, 101 W Main Street Madison, IN 47250. Meeting dates are subject to change. Please see the meeting tab below for upcoming meeting dates.
Meetings are also live streamed on the City of Madison YouTube channel.
